Abstract :
An accurate, analytical method is proposed for calculating the lead and winding high-frequency resistance of complex transformer constructions. High-frequency resistance is derived from the resulting matrix system equations, common to the leads and windings. The effect of eddy currents in the leads is confirmed by theoretical results. The high-frequency resistances of three winding arrangements are compared, and a winding geometry that reduces winding high-frequency resistance is derived
